1. ABSTRACT

As the world is being created with the modern technologies, finding and controlling modern

thoughts and ideas of taking everything online are quickly changing. It is troublesome for

teachers to circulate their notes to each and each student whom is he/she educating. Notes

management system give a straightforward approach for both students and instructors to

circulate the notes whether of any kind like address notes, task questions, address papers and

all the vital archives. The instructors and students can transfer the reports from anyplace and

anyone can download it. Generally, it is managed by the admin.

Notes management system deals with borrowing and exchanging the notes from senior

student to junior student. It is a WEB-based framework particularly planned for students of

specific college. This system is being delivered for students curious about borrowing and

giving their own notes for the free of cost. It'll permit the student to make an a/c and joins the

gathering.

5. Implementation or architecture diagrams:

A. System Architecture Design:

1. Base layer

The base layer provides the fundamental software and hardware environment required for

the system, including network, server, storage, firewall, UPS, operating system, and so on.

2. Data Layer

The data layer stores all the data resources which are needed within the system, including

disaster data, location data, user data and so on.

3. Application Layer

The application layer provides the communication bridge between user operations and

background database. The key function modules include load balancing, data analysis, data

management, data backup, portal integration, other web services, and so on.

4. Interactive Layer

The interactive layer provides the interface and interactive operations for users and managers.

The interactive operations include user management, data management, data query, data

export, system management, data analysis, and so on.

B. Technologies used:

The system has easily accessible interface and contains many important options. In this

network-based software, DJANGO and HTML has been used as a front-end software

programming language and MYSQL as back end for database.

1. Front End (HTML & DJANGO):

Hypertext Mark-up Language is basic language to develop Webpages. DJANGO is a server

side scripting language. Server-side scripting means the output of actual code comes after

executing it into web server. DJANGO code executes on web server and provides output as

normal web page.

Downloaded by Pallavi Pandey ([email protected])


lOMoARcPSD|16044656

2 Back End (MYSQL):

MySQL is relational database Management System software which is often used with

DJANGO. MySQL is extremely fast reliable and versatile management System. It provides a

really high performance and it's multi-threaded and multi user relational database

management system. MySQL provides high security and straight forward.

3 Application Server (WAMP):

Wamp Server is a Windows web development environment. It allows creating web

applications with DJANGO and MySQL database.

4 IDE:(Integrated Development Environment): An IDE normally consists of a source code

editor, compiler, interpreter, debugger/ Tester.
